+Based on the previous investigations, we summarize the obtained results in table~\ref{tab:result}. The following criteria 
+have been used to compare the extractors:
+
+\begin{itemize}
+\item Stability of the reconstructed charge in the calibration. Extractors with more than 5\% of the pixels excluded from the 
+calibration with any colour or intensity are considered as too unstable. Also extractors yielding more than 0.1\% mis-reconstructed 
+events are excluded. Moreover, the correct number of photo-electrons should be reconstructed at least for the standard calibration 
+pulses (10\,LEDs\,UV).
+\item The extractor should yield stable results against slight modifications of the pulse shape. 
+\item The extractor must also yield the correct charges for the low-gain pulses on average.
+\item The reconstructed charge must be linear to the input signal charge for all signals above the image cleaning level and below 
+the low-gain saturation level.
+\item The resolution of the reconstructed charge should not depend significantly on the signal amplitude, especially should never 
+become comparable to the intrinsic Poissonian signal fluctuations. 
+\item The resolution of the reconstructed charge should not exceed twice the resolution of the best extractor.
+\item The extractor should not have a charge bias bigger than its charge resolution.
+\item The time resolution should not be worse than twice the one obtainable with the best extractor.
+\item The number of mis-reconstruced times should not exceed 1\% on average (including the FADC jumps).
+\item The needed CPU-time should not exceed the one required for reading the data into memory and writing it to disk.
+\end{itemize}
+
+Table~\ref{tab:result} shows which extractors fulfill the above criteria. One can see that there are a handful extractors which 
+are excluded by only one criterion:
+
+\begin{itemize}
+\item The sliding window extracting 8 slices in high- and low-gain which is only excluded by the poor resolution at very low intensities.
+ 
+\item The integrating spline over 2 FADC slices which still needs to be optimized somewhat for speed.
+\end{itemize}
+
+The digital filter passes all tests, where the extraction over 4 FADC slices yields still superior resolutions compared to the one 
+over 6~FADC slices.
